Minutes — Management Meeting, Corliss Holdings

Present: executive team; chaired by M. Ostrova. Agenda item one: the delayed Wrenfield tooling project. Delivery now projected eight weeks late due to vendor rework and staffing gaps in the Pellam office. Remediation plan approved: reassign two leads, compress the testing phase, weekly status reports to the board. Budget impact estimated as minor but under review. No other items raised. Meeting closed at noon. The confidential business note for board members follows immediately below.

confidential, bawig-bajeg: Headcount on the Oliix team goes from 5 to 80 by the end of January. Gross margin on Oliix came in at 10 percent against a plan of 20 percent.

Changed defaults in Splitfork, our assignment service. Bucketing now uses sticky hashing per account instead of per session, and the holdout slice grew from 2% to 5%. Callers relying on session-level reassignment must opt in explicitly. Review the diff against the new baseline; the updated default configuration is listed below.

config for tagep-kajof:
[casir]
port = 6379
region = south-1
host = casir.paliqdyn.example
team = tamax
timeout_ms = 250
retries = 2

/*
 * Order-cutoff rule for the Millbrindle bakery client.
 * Orders placed after 14:00 local bakery time roll to the
 * next business day. Do not hardcode the cutoff here; it is
 * fetched from the Ovengate config service at startup and
 * cached for one hour. If the fetch fails, we fail closed
 * and reject new orders rather than guessing. The config
 * service rejects unauthenticated reads. The client below
 * must be initialized with the service key that follows.
 */

API key for yahig-tadup: kto7_ubizbYm

## Configuration — Sprigminder

Sprigminder reads its watering schedule and sensor thresholds from config.yaml, but runtime secrets must come from the environment, never the config file. Support staff setting up a new greenhouse controller should copy env.sample to .env, fill in the zone names, and then add the controller's API credential. That credential is set with this exact line.

vault entry, yahif-yajep: COURIER_KEY29=b802bdf8034096b65a51c6ba5abe2